Transaction 4eee1599113ae2a8213beea4ac7a9196c3bb04b1b51ba7e170821caae5f0c093

100 Input
1 Outputs
  • 4eee1599113ae2a8213beea4ac7a9196c3bb04b1b51ba7e170821caae5f0c093:0
  • value  50910202
    address  1PMq9h8op2doKqP63QruxsVJEfPwzL7GEd